package model_test
import (
"context"
"errors"
"testing"
"github.com/launchdarkly/go-sdk-common/v3/ldvalue"
"github.com/launchdarkly/ldcli/internal/dev_server/model"
"github.com/launchdarkly/ldcli/internal/dev_server/model/mocks"
"github.com/stretchr/testify/assert"
"go.uber.org/mock/gomock"
)
func TestUpsertOverride(t *testing.T) {
t.Parallel()
ctx := context.Background()
mockController := gomock.NewController(t)
defer mockController.Finish()
store := mocks.NewMockStore(mockController)
projKey := t.Name()
flagKey := "flg"
ldValue := ldvalue.Bool(true)
override := model.Override{
ProjectKey: projKey,
FlagKey: flagKey,
Value: ldValue,
Active: true,
Version: 1,
}
project := &model.Project{
Key: projKey,
AllFlagsState: model.FlagsState{flagKey: model.FlagState{Value: ldvalue.Bool(false), Version: 1}},
}
ctx = model.ContextWithStore(ctx, store)
observers := model.NewObservers()
observer := mocks.NewMockObserver(mockController)
observers.RegisterObserver(observer)
ctx = model.SetObserversOnContext(ctx, observers)
t.Run("store unable to get project, returns error", func(t *testing.T) {
store.EXPECT().GetDevProject(gomock.Any(), projKey).Return(nil, errors.New("test 2"))
_, err := model.UpsertOverride(ctx, projKey, flagKey, ldValue)
assert.Error(t, err)
})
t.Run("Returns error if flag does not exist in project", func(t *testing.T) {
badProj := model.Project{
Key: projKey,
AllFlagsState: model.FlagsState{},
}
store.EXPECT().GetDevProject(gomock.Any(), projKey).Return(&badProj, nil)
_, err := model.UpsertOverride(ctx, projKey, flagKey, ldValue)
assert.Error(t, err)
assert.ErrorAs(t, err, &model.ErrNotFound{})
})
t.Run("store fails to upsert, returns error", func(t *testing.T) {
store.EXPECT().GetDevProject(gomock.Any(), projKey).Return(project, nil)
store.EXPECT().UpsertOverride(gomock.Any(), gomock.Any()).Return(model.Override{}, errors.New("testy test"))
_, err := model.UpsertOverride(ctx, projKey, flagKey, ldValue)
assert.Error(t, err)
assert.Equal(t, "testy test", err.Error())
})
t.Run("override is applied, observers are notified", func(t *testing.T) {
store.EXPECT().GetDevProject(gomock.Any(), projKey).Return(project, nil)
store.EXPECT().UpsertOverride(gomock.Any(), override).Return(override, nil)
store.EXPECT().IncrementProjectPayloadVersion(gomock.Any(), projKey).Return(1, nil)
observer.
EXPECT().
Handle(model.OverrideEvent{
FlagKey: flagKey,
ProjectKey: projKey,
FlagState: model.FlagState{Value: ldvalue.Bool(true), Version: 2, TrackEvents: true},
})
o, err := model.UpsertOverride(ctx, projKey, flagKey, ldValue)
assert.Nil(t, err)
assert.Equal(t, override, o)
})
}
func TestDeleteOverride(t *testing.T) {
t.Parallel()
ctx := context.Background()
mockController := gomock.NewController(t)
defer mockController.Finish()
store := mocks.NewMockStore(mockController)
projKey := t.Name()
flagKey := "flg"
ldValue := ldvalue.Bool(true)
project := &model.Project{
Key: projKey,
AllFlagsState: model.FlagsState{flagKey: model.FlagState{Value: ldvalue.Bool(false), Version: 1}},
}
ctx = model.ContextWithStore(ctx, store)
observers := model.NewObservers()
observer := mocks.NewMockObserver(mockController)
observers.RegisterObserver(observer)
ctx = model.SetObserversOnContext(ctx, observers)
t.Run("store unable to get project, returns error", func(t *testing.T) {
store.EXPECT().GetDevProject(gomock.Any(), projKey).Return(nil, errors.New("test 2"))
_, err := model.UpsertOverride(ctx, projKey, flagKey, ldValue)
assert.Error(t, err)
})
t.Run("Returns error if store errors on delete", func(t *testing.T) {
store.EXPECT().GetDevProject(gomock.Any(), projKey).Return(project, nil)
store.EXPECT().DeactivateOverride(gomock.Any(), projKey, flagKey).Return(0, errors.New("store error on deactive override"))
err := model.DeleteOverride(ctx, projKey, flagKey)
assert.Error(t, err)
})
t.Run("override is applied, observers are notified", func(t *testing.T) {
store.EXPECT().GetDevProject(gomock.Any(), projKey).Return(project, nil)
store.EXPECT().DeactivateOverride(gomock.Any(), projKey, flagKey).Return(2, nil)
store.EXPECT().IncrementProjectPayloadVersion(gomock.Any(), projKey).Return(1, nil)
observer.
EXPECT().
Handle(model.OverrideEvent{
FlagKey: flagKey,
ProjectKey: projKey,
FlagState: model.FlagState{
Value: ldvalue.Bool(false),
Version: 3, // override version 2 + flag version 1
},
})
err := model.DeleteOverride(ctx, projKey, flagKey)
assert.Nil(t, err)
})
}
func TestDeleteOverrides(t *testing.T) {
mockController := gomock.NewController(t)
defer mockController.Finish()
store := mocks.NewMockStore(mockController)
ctx := context.Background()
projKey := "proj"
flagKey := "flg"
project := &model.Project{
Key: projKey,
AllFlagsState: model.FlagsState{
flagKey: model.FlagState{Value: ldvalue.Bool(false), Version: 1},
"flag2": model.FlagState{Value: ldvalue.Bool(false), Version: 1},
},
}
ctx = model.ContextWithStore(ctx, store)
observers := model.NewObservers()
observer := mocks.NewMockObserver(mockController)
observers.RegisterObserver(observer)
ctx = model.SetObserversOnContext(ctx, observers)
t.Run("Returns error if store fails to get overrides", func(t *testing.T) {
store.EXPECT().GetOverridesForProject(gomock.Any(), projKey).Return(nil, errors.New("store error"))
err := model.DeleteOverrides(ctx, projKey)
assert.Error(t, err)
})
t.Run("Returns error if deleting an override fails", func(t *testing.T) {
overrides := model.Overrides{
{ProjectKey: projKey, FlagKey: flagKey},
}
store.EXPECT().GetOverridesForProject(gomock.Any(), projKey).Return(overrides, nil)
store.EXPECT().GetDevProject(gomock.Any(), projKey).Return(project, nil)
store.EXPECT().DeactivateOverride(gomock.Any(), projKey, flagKey).Return(0, errors.New("delete error"))
err := model.DeleteOverrides(ctx, projKey)
assert.Error(t, err)
})
t.Run("Successfully deletes all overrides", func(t *testing.T) {
overrides := model.Overrides{
{ProjectKey: projKey, FlagKey: flagKey},
{ProjectKey: projKey, FlagKey: "flag2"},
}
store.EXPECT().GetOverridesForProject(gomock.Any(), projKey).Return(overrides, nil)
// Expectations for first override
store.EXPECT().GetDevProject(gomock.Any(), projKey).Return(project, nil)
store.EXPECT().DeactivateOverride(gomock.Any(), projKey, flagKey).Return(2, nil)
store.EXPECT().IncrementProjectPayloadVersion(gomock.Any(), projKey).Return(1, nil)
observer.EXPECT().Handle(gomock.Any())
// Expectations for second override
store.EXPECT().GetDevProject(gomock.Any(), projKey).Return(project, nil)
store.EXPECT().DeactivateOverride(gomock.Any(), projKey, "flag2").Return(2, nil)
store.EXPECT().IncrementProjectPayloadVersion(gomock.Any(), projKey).Return(2, nil)
observer.EXPECT().Handle(gomock.Any())
err := model.DeleteOverrides(ctx, projKey)
assert.Nil(t, err)
})
}
func TestOverrideApply(t *testing.T) {
projKey := "proj"
flagKey := "flg"
ldValue := ldvalue.Bool(true)
oldState := model.FlagState{Value: ldvalue.Bool(false), Version: 1}
t.Run("if override is inactive, increment version", func(t *testing.T) {
override := model.Override{
ProjectKey: projKey,
FlagKey: flagKey,
Value: ldValue,
Version: 1,
}
state := override.Apply(oldState)
assert.False(t, state.Value.BoolValue())
assert.Equal(t, 2, state.Version)
})
t.Run("if override is active, increment version AND update value", func(t *testing.T) {
override := model.Override{
ProjectKey: projKey,
FlagKey: flagKey,
Value: ldValue,
Active: true,
Version: 1,
}
state := override.Apply(oldState)
assert.True(t, state.Value.BoolValue())
assert.Equal(t, 2, state.Version)
})
}
